that's just obviously false.

deflation incentivizes ALL market participants to hold their money.
all holders of the money reap the reward of the economic ventures of others. if economic growth occurs, their money increases in purchasing power whether ir not they participate.
purchasing power increases directly along the economic activity generated by *anyone*
it is a poor incentive structure where everyone benefits from the activity of the few.

also the prospective entrepreneur or any capital venture needs to be confident they can not only beat the market but has the additional hurdle of needing to beat the rate of monetary deflation.

i agree deflationary cycles are normal and good.
permanent structural deflation is not.
